From 281d2f2dc27a2d0761e0f761e11ab38638ef7653 Mon Sep 17 00:00:00 2001 From: Thomas1664 <46387399+Thomas1664@users.noreply.github.com> Date: Fri, 29 Jul 2022 21:57:10 +0200 Subject: [PATCH] [libsndfile] Remove docs (#26017) * [libsndfile] Remove docs * version * `PYTHON_EXECUTABLE` is only used with `BUILD_SHARED_LIBS` * version * Fix license * version * license * version --- ports/libsndfile/portfile.cmake | 14 ++++++++------ ports/libsndfile/vcpkg.json | 3 ++- versions/baseline.json | 2 +- versions/l-/libsndfile.json | 5 +++++ 4 files changed, 16 insertions(+), 8 deletions(-) diff --git a/ports/libsndfile/portfile.cmake b/ports/libsndfile/portfile.cmake index 7c31e3468a8..e6ad23df30b 100644 --- a/ports/libsndfile/portfile.cmake +++ b/ports/libsndfile/portfile.cmake @@ -26,7 +26,7 @@ if(VCPKG_TARGET_IS_UWP) endif() vcpkg_cmake_configure( - SOURCE_PATH ${SOURCE_PATH} + SOURCE_PATH "${SOURCE_PATH}" OPTIONS -DBUILD_EXAMPLES=OFF -DBUILD_TESTING=OFF @@ -36,6 +36,8 @@ vcpkg_cmake_configure( -DCMAKE_FIND_PACKAGE_PREFER_CONFIG=ON -DPYTHON_EXECUTABLE=${PYTHON3} ${FEATURE_OPTIONS} + MAYBE_UNUSED_VARIABLES + PYTHON_EXECUTABLE ) vcpkg_cmake_install() @@ -46,13 +48,13 @@ else() set(CONFIG_PATH lib/cmake/SndFile) endif() -vcpkg_cmake_config_fixup(PACKAGE_NAME SndFile CONFIG_PATH ${CONFIG_PATH}) +vcpkg_cmake_config_fixup(PACKAGE_NAME SndFile CONFIG_PATH "${CONFIG_PATH}") vcpkg_fixup_pkgconfig(SYSTEM_LIBRARIES m) vcpkg_copy_pdbs() -file(REMOVE_RECURSE ${CURRENT_PACKAGES_DIR}/debug/share) -file(REMOVE_RECURSE ${CURRENT_PACKAGES_DIR}/debug/include) +file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/debug/share") +file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/debug/include") +file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/share/doc") -# Handle copyright -file(INSTALL ${SOURCE_PATH}/COPYING DESTINATION ${CURRENT_PACKAGES_DIR}/share/${PORT} RENAME copyright) +file(INSTALL "${SOURCE_PATH}/COPYING" DESTINATION "${CURRENT_PACKAGES_DIR}/share/${PORT}" RENAME copyright) diff --git a/ports/libsndfile/vcpkg.json b/ports/libsndfile/vcpkg.json index 20c29ae2ae0..ad775ca2136 100644 --- a/ports/libsndfile/vcpkg.json +++ b/ports/libsndfile/vcpkg.json @@ -1,9 +1,10 @@ { "name": "libsndfile", "version-semver": "1.1.0", + "port-version": 1, "description": "A library for reading and writing audio files", "homepage": "https://github.com/erikd/libsndfile", - "license": "LGPL-2.1", + "license": "LGPL-2.1-or-later", "dependencies": [ { "name": "vcpkg-cmake", diff --git a/versions/baseline.json b/versions/baseline.json index c25a8cc6359..18fb07c3f97 100644 --- a/versions/baseline.json +++ b/versions/baseline.json @@ -4078,7 +4078,7 @@ }, "libsndfile": { "baseline": "1.1.0", - "port-version": 0 + "port-version": 1 }, "libsnoretoast": { "baseline": "0.8.0", diff --git a/versions/l-/libsndfile.json b/versions/l-/libsndfile.json index b1d58472db8..83ba3f8b327 100644 --- a/versions/l-/libsndfile.json +++ b/versions/l-/libsndfile.json @@ -1,5 +1,10 @@ { "versions": [ + { + "git-tree": "ee6720c9ecc42994e16325893fcc740b28210533", + "version-semver": "1.1.0", + "port-version": 1 + }, { "git-tree": "1ec8249a4721dda26735a12603defe2aa680c264", "version-semver": "1.1.0",